UK attends African Union Summit

UK attends African Union Summit

01 July 2009

LONDON, United-Kingdom:  Foreign Office Minister Lord Malloch-Brown joins other world and African ministers and heads of state for the African Union (AU) Summit in Libya on 1-2 July. AU member states will discuss pressing African issues such as Sudan and Somalia as well as global issues such as the impact of the economic crisis on Africa.  There will [...]

Yemenia: Previous Incident in Eritrea

Yemenia: Previous Incident in Eritrea

30 June 2009

The Yemenia Airbus A310 crash in the Indian Ocean near the Comoros follows an overhaul inspection of safety procedures, which took place at Yemenia Airline. The inspection was carried out in a bid to avoid being blacklisted by the European Union. According to Air Transport Intelligence the airline has been scrutinised in the past many times before, [...]
